St. Agnes' Academy Main Building (Legazpi City)

Built in 1920, it is the first building constructed in this campus and is one of the oldest existing buildings in Legazpi to have survived until today.

During it's early years, it was once home to the sister's convent, the administration offices(including the offices of the Directress, HS and GS Principal, Assistant Principal, Coordinators, Property Custodian, Treasurer, and registrar), the school dormitory, chapel, faculty room, sewing room, type writing room, home economics room, guidance office, music room, laboratories and all the classes of the Academy from elementary to highschool.

Due to space problems the Benedictines decided to build another building, the Santa Maria Building. The GS Department then transferred to their new home.

Today, after 90 years of existence, only the HS Library, Fcaulty room, chapel, admin offices and some HS sections are left in this building.
